7. Comet Assay: DNA-Damaged Sperm

Rating:
Comet Assay: DNA-Damaged Sperm Details:
Real-time modified alkaline SCGE assay showing fluorescent DNA unraveling from damaged sperm nucleus and forming comet tail. Am J Obstet Gynecol. 2001;184:1068.

8. Sperm Comet Assay (SCGE)

Rating:
Sperm Comet Assay (SCGE) Details:
DNA damage (single and double strand breaks) in alkaline comet assay is revealed by streaking tail from a diminished sperm nucleus. Fertil Steril 75:1-4,2001
